George Zornick: Washington Finally Pays Attention to Afghanistan—for All the Wrong Reasons
October 11, 2013 - Segment 6
- We have a special report from George Zornick, writer for The Nation, on the 12th anniversary of the war in Afghanistan. His piece is titled, "Washington Finally Pays Attention to Afghanistan—for All the Wrong Reasons."
